跨平台离线缓存,畅享无缝移动体验
|
在当今移动应用快速发展的时代,用户对应用的性能和体验提出了更高的要求。作为Vue开发工程师,我们深知跨平台开发的重要性,而离线缓存则是提升用户体验的关键技术之一。 Vue框架本身具备良好的组件化和响应式特性,使得我们在构建跨平台应用时更加得心应手。通过使用Vue与原生平台结合的方式,如Vue Native或Capacitor,我们可以实现一次开发,多端运行。 离线缓存的核心在于数据的本地存储与高效访问。借助IndexedDB或LocalStorage,我们可以将关键数据缓存到用户的设备上,确保在网络不稳定或无网络的情况下,应用依然能够正常运行。 同时,我们还需要考虑缓存策略的合理性。例如,采用时间戳机制判断缓存是否过期,或者根据业务需求设置不同的缓存优先级,以平衡性能与数据准确性。 为了提升用户体验,我们还可以引入Service Worker来管理资源的缓存,实现更智能的离线加载和资源预取。这不仅提升了应用的响应速度,也减少了用户的等待时间。 跨平台开发中需要关注不同平台的特性差异。比如,在iOS中需要注意后台任务的限制,而在Android中则需要合理处理内存管理。这些细节的把握,直接影响到应用的稳定性和流畅性。
图画AI生成,仅供参考 通过合理的架构设计和代码优化,我们可以让应用在各种环境下都能保持稳定的性能表现。无论是城市中的地铁隧道,还是偏远地区的信号盲区,用户都能享受到无缝的移动体验。 作为一名Vue开发工程师,持续学习和探索新技术是我们的职责。只有不断优化应用的性能和功能,才能真正满足用户日益增长的需求。 (编辑:91站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

